Conference Relations: Supply Pastor Methodist Episcopal Erie Conference 1907; Deacon 1929, Mead; Elder 1931, Welch; Deceased: February 26, 1939 in Hazen, (Dubois) Pennsylvania. Buried in Curwensville/New Bethlehem Cemetery, Pennsylvania. Born September 10, 1872 in Mount Forest, Canada. (Her memoir is in 1971 Journal, page 405).
Appointment Records: Columbus/North Corry 1907-1910; Centerville/Riceville/Britton Run 1910-1912; Sunville (Chapmanville) 1912-1915; Watts Flats/Lottsville 1915-1918; Garland/Grand Valley 1918-1919; Wampum/Newport 1919-1920; Kane Circuit: East Kane 1920-1921 Hawthorn/Oak Ridge/Leasure Run 1921-1925; Callensburg/West Freedom 1925-1929; Rockland/Van 1929-1935; Hazen/Munderf: Zion/Lake City/Allen's Mills: Newman's Chapel/Richardsville 1935-1939.
